Output e8d605c7f1c23edc0e91de52cfbbb63cf7348d9829a25dcf3210b7f29fef510f:24

value
377027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c80f96ee5a0594118d885ca8cf5bc7f42c50081c OP_EQUAL
address
3Kvqk6KHp6w9Ae73fMDFzSu3XqGSZ3FhNy
transaction
e8d605c7f1c23edc0e91de52cfbbb63cf7348d9829a25dcf3210b7f29fef510f
spent
true